It fetches candidate RSS feeds, validates enclosure tags, episode GUIDs, and artwork dimensions, then writes results to the validation ledger. Most logic lives in the parser module; the rules engine is table-driven, so new checks usually mean a config row, not code. Cron kicks off a full revalidation nightly, and failures page the on-call rotation. Results older than ninety days are pruned automatically. To run FeedCheck locally, point it at the validation database using the connection string below.

replica DSN, yahaf-yagaf: mongodb://tamath_svc:a2netSk3RZMuTj@db-d084.novacsoft.internal:5432/ralmir

So the telemetry gateway for the HarrowLink fleet keeps dropping its DB connection every 40-ish minutes, usually mid-batch, and we end up with half-written sensor rows. I suspect the pool is recycling connections faster than the writer flushes. I've bumped the idle timeout and added retry-with-backoff in `writer.go` — please sanity-check that logic, since I wrote it at 11pm. To reproduce locally, run the ingest sim against staging and watch the pool stats. Staging uses the connection string below.

primary connection of kajop-yahap = postgresql://pelax_svc:EQ@db-49fe.tolvaqgrid.example:5432/zormir

Ticket SEARCH-RELEVANCE — Ostermark Findr. Tuning notes for the synonym expansion pass are attached; reviewers should confirm that boosted fields never surface restricted-catalog items to anonymous sessions. We verified the ranking model reads only sanitized inputs. For audit purposes, the signed trace token for this evaluation run is recorded immediately below.

session token of yajof-bagef = htk4_937d